I own a SG150R (SKYGO Earl Classic 150) for more than a year now as my very first modern-classic bike and reliable utility. One particular spec of my bike worth mentioning is the 14-liter gas tank, quite bigger in capacity than as compared to the 13.5-liter the Classic 400 you mentioned. Actually, among my fellow Klasikos in our Moto Club (majority of which are CR152s and TMX125s), Skygo's Earl has the largest tank capacity which is able to bring me full-tank back and forth - Pangasinan to NCR vice versa. I experienced riding to NCR from Pangasinan 4 times already and it remained the same, full tank of gas can return me home to Lingayen with a little reserve left inside.
